Begin at home

I note in the article on the Tynedale Beer Festival in Corbridge (Courant July 27) that the majority of the money raised was going, among other charities, to St. Oswald’s Hospice in Gosforth.

This is a very worthy cause, I know, but it seems a shame that Tynedale Hospice at Home which gives care, in their homes, to people suffering life limiting diseases as well as running a bereavement counselling service for both adults and children, in Tynedale and beyond, was not one of the main beneficiaries.

Like a lot of charities it has had its funding cut and needs all the money it can get.
